153 clashes reported along frontlines over past 24 hours – Ukraine’s General Staff

Source: Ukraine’s General Staff

Intense fighting raged across several key frontlines as of 10:00 PM on August 14 with 153 combat clashes reported, according to Ukraine’s General Staff.

The Pokrovske sector accounted for a third of all combat engagements over the last 24 hours.

Russian forces, backed up by aviation, launched four assaults on Ukrainian positions near Vovchansk and Sotnytsky Kozachok in the Kharkiv region. Ukrainian defenders eliminated or injured over 70 Russian soldiers, destroyed a tank, five armored vehicles, an artillery system, 30 UAVs, and several other military vehicles.

In the Kupiansk area, Ukrainian forces repelled eight of nine Russian attacks near Synkivka, Petropavlivka, and Berestove. Intense combat continues.

The Lyman sector saw 15 Russian attacks near Makiivka, Nevske, and Terny, with two clashes still ongoing. In the Siversk sector, Russian forces attempted 24 assaults, with seven battles still active.

Ukrainian soldiers thwarted four out of five attacks near Chasiv Yar and Andriivka in the Kramatorsk area, with one ongoing fight. In Toretsk, 21 Russian assaults were recorded, with 18 repelled. Fighting continues in three locations.

The Pokrovske direction remains the primary focus for Russian forces, who launched 55 attacks, losing over 250 soldiers and several vehicles. Ukrainian defenders have already repelled 40 attacks, with 15 more clashes still underway.

In the Kurakhove area, Ukrainian forces held off five Russian assaults near Kostyantynivka and Krasnohorivka, with one battle still ongoing. The Vremivka front saw six Russian assaults, with four repelled and two continuing. The Orikhiv and Prydniprovske directions witnessed unsuccessful Russian attacks, with no territorial losses for Ukraine.

The General Staff made a special mention to the soldiers of the 67th Separate Mechanized Brigade for their “effective combat efforts”.
